founders' shares
- shares of stock given, at least nominally, for consideration to the organizers or original subscribers of a corporation, sometimes carrying special voting privileges, but likely to receive dividends after other classes of stock.
founders' shares
- shares awarded to the founders of a company and often granting special privileges
